What is the main emphasis of karate?

Self-discipline, positive attitude, and high moral purpose

Where did karate originate and how old is it?

Karate originated in eastern Asia and is more than 1000 years old

Who introduced karate to the Japanese public?

Funakoshi Gichin

What are the three vital elements to karate expertise?

Speed, strength, and technique

What distinguishes karate from judo and jujutsu?

Karate stresses striking techniques with lethal kicks and punches

What are the requisites for karate expertise besides speed, strength, and technique?

Constant alertness and a keen sense of timing and surprise

What are some common areas targeted in karate competitions or exhibitions?

Face, neck, solar plexus, spinal column, groin, and kidneys

What is the traditional garment worn in karate training called?

Gi

What does a black belt in karate signify?

Highest proficiency

What is the term used for the highest dan in karate?

Ninth or tenth degree

What are some common blows used in karate?

Chops, knife hands, knuckle punches, hammer-blows, finger jabs, kicks

What is the term for the karate training hall or gym?

Dojo
